Access is a fundamental component in effective UI/UX design that ought to not be neglected. Producing digital experiences that are inclusive for all users, including those with impairments, is both a legal obligation and a moral crucial. Developers ought to take into consideration numerous availability requirements, such as WCAG (Web Content Accessibility Guidelines), during the design process, guaranteeing that color comparison suffices, that there are different message descriptions for images, which navigating is simple for users with assistive modern technologies. By focusing on availability, designers not just broaden their individual base but additionally improve the overall customer experience.

The importance of branding in UI/UX design ought to also be emphasized. An item's user interface must not only satisfy functional needs however likewise reflect the brand name's identification. Consistency in design elements-- such as shades, icons, typography, and tone of voice-- aid individuals acknowledge and connect with a brand. This acknowledgment promotes a sense of commitment and count on, as users involve comprehend what to anticipate from a brand name's services and items. As a result, incorporating brand name elements right into UI/UX design is essential not just for aesthetic objectives but additionally for developing a much deeper emotional link with users.
